Nigeria – The Department of State Services (DSS) has announced the redeployment of its Director of Public Relations and Strategic Communications, Peter Afunanya. Afunanya made the announcement at a press briefing in Abuja on Wednesday, but declined to disclose his new duty post, citing the redeployment as a routine exercise in the service to the nation.

Afunanya has been serving in the media section of the secret police for over 10 years, having taken up the role at a time when the agency was facing challenges with its public image. He replaced Marilyn Ogar, who was compulsorily retired from service in 2015 after investigations into allegations of bribery and professional misconduct.

Ogar’s departure was met with widespread controversy, with allegations of corruption and partisanship levelled against her. She denied all the allegations, maintaining her innocence. Afunanya expressed his gratitude for the opportunity to serve the country as the spokesman of the covert security outfit and pledged to continue doing his best in whatever capacity he is chosen to serve.

The newly appointed Director-General of the DSS, Adeola Oluwatosin Ajayi, took office last Thursday, vowing to refocus the service towards covertness and silence. Prior to his appointment, Ajayi served as the Kogi State director of the DSS. He also pledged to work towards surmounting challenges facing Nigeria’s economic, political, and security environments.

Afunanya expressed his commitment to carrying out his duty with “love, loyalty, honour, and glory” and vowed to continue serving the country with dedication. The redeployment of Afunanya is seen as a routine exercise in the service, aimed at ensuring continued efficiency and effectiveness in the discharge of its duties.
